‘Shape of You’ singer says he used to eat until he was sick during his 2014 ‘X’ tour
about anxiety and wellbeing where he opened up about how his hectic 180-date touring schedule for the album“I would stay up and drink all night and then sleep on the bus ... It’s all fun and games at the start, but then it starts getting sad,” Sheeran said. “That was probably the lowest that I’ve been and I ballooned in weight. They used to call me ‘two-dinner Teddy’ because I used to order two meals and eat that.
